Do Clock Tree Synthesis (CTS)

1. Goto Edit ---> create non default rule ---> 2w2s


EDit
2. Write a CTS script file with following content and save it as
‘[Link]’

create_route_type -name clkroute -non_default_rule 2w2s -bottom_preferred_layer


Metal5 -top_preferred_layer Metal6
set_ccopt_property route_type clkroute -net_type trunk
set_ccopt_property route_type clkroute -net_type leaf

##Specify Buffers Inverters and Clock Gating


set_ccopt_property buffer_cells {CLKBUFX2 CLKBUFX4}
set_ccopt_property inverter_cells {CLKINVX2 CLKINVX4}
set_ccopt_property clock_gating_cells TLATNTSCA*

##Generate the ccopt file and source it


create_ccopt_clock_tree_spec -file [Link]
In the terminal
>source [Link]
****RUN CTS****
>ccopt_design –cts

****SAVEDESIGN*****
>saveDesign
DBS/cts.enc1
